What Is an axially loaded column?
28.1 INTRODUCTION. A reinforced concrete column is said to be subjected to an axial load when the line of the resultant thrust of loads supported by the column is coincident with the line of C.G. of the column in the longitudinal direction.

What is pure axial load?
Pure Axial Stress is typically found in two-force members. If a member has a force F, the axial stress is σx=F/A, where A is the cross-sectional area of the member. Subsequently, the axial strain is εx= σx/E, where E is the Modulus of Elasticity.
What loaded column?
Columns are structural members that are loaded parallel to their length. Most columns are vertical and are used to carry loads from a higher level to a lower level. However any member subjected to compression loads, such as a diagonal or prop brace, is a column.

How do I find a axially loaded column?
Load carrying capacity of column will depend upon the percentage of steel reinforcement, grade of concrete and column size for various mixes and steel. Pu =0.4 fck Ac + 0.67 fy Asc as per IS 456-2000. 2. Here in the Table P is Axial Load Carrying capacity of column in KN.

What is axial load and radial load?
Radial Load is defined as the maximum force that can be applied to the shaft in the radial direction (any direction perpendicular to the motor shaft axis). Axial Load is defined as the maximum force that can be applied to the shaft in the axial direction (in the same axis as or parallel to the motor shaft axis).

What is critical load in column?
The critical load is the greatest load that will not cause lateral deflection (buckling). For loads greater than the critical load, the column will deflect laterally. The critical load puts the column in a state of unstable equilibrium. A load beyond the critical load causes the column to fail by buckling.
